In the evolving world of crypto trading, one of the most important choices every trader faces is where to trade โ€” and that starts with deciding between a Centralized Exchange (CEX) and a Decentralized Exchange (DEX).

Each option brings its own strengths and limitations. Understanding the trade-offs in security, liquidity, user experience, and asset control is key to becoming a risk-aware, confident trader.

๐Ÿ’ก CEX vs DEX โ€” Whatโ€™s the Difference?

CEXs (Centralized Exchanges) like Binance, Coinbase, and Kraken are platforms run by centralized companies. They often offer:

Fast transactions with high liquidity

User-friendly interfaces

Fiat support and customer service

Regulatory compliance (KYC/AML)

DEXs (Decentralized Exchanges) like Uniswap, PancakeSwap, or GMX run on smart contracts and allow peer-to-peer trading directly from your wallet, offering:

Full custody of your funds

No sign-ups or KYC

Access to new and niche tokens

Higher privacy and decentralization

๐Ÿง  Questions to Ask Yourself

When deciding between a CEX and a DEX, consider the following:

๐Ÿ”ธ How important is self-custody?

๐Ÿ”ธ Do I need fiat access or am I crypto-native?

๐Ÿ”ธ Is the token Iโ€™m trading available on both?

๐Ÿ”ธ How comfortable am I with managing private keys and smart contract risk?

๐Ÿงญ For DEX First-Timers โ€” Pro Tips

Thinking of trying a DEX for the first time? Hereโ€™s my advice:

๐Ÿ” Use a secure wallet (hardware preferred)

๐Ÿงช Start small with test trades

๐Ÿ” Always verify token contract addresses

๐Ÿ“‰ Understand slippage and gas fees

๐Ÿ›‘ Avoid unknown DEXs without community or code audits
